All nice plants. I'm still waiting for the vote to finish on the spring project. For your uploading pictures, I have to hit the browse find pic upload it then hit the browse again. I have to upload every picture then just go back to the top browse and do it again. I hope that makes sense.
I use to be able to do it by hitting the first browse then I could hit the second and so forth. But for some reason now I have to hit upload between every picture. Try this and see if it works for you.
